Jenna Jamison on Tactical Execution Analysis

In the world of business, tactical execution analysis is an essential component of any successful strategy. This process involves breaking down a plan into actionable steps, analyzing potential obstacles and risks, and determining the most effective ways to achieve desired outcomes.

Jenna Jamison, a seasoned entrepreneur and business strategist, understands the importance of tactical execution analysis. Throughout her career, she has worked with numerous companies to help them develop and implement effective strategies that drive growth and success.

One of Jenna's key insights is that tactical execution analysis must be approached with a clear understanding of the organization's goals and objectives. This means taking the time to define specific outcomes, identifying key performance indicators, and developing a robust measurement framework.

Once these foundational elements are in place, the tactical execution analysis process can begin. This involves breaking down a broader strategy into smaller, more manageable components, each with its own set of metrics and timelines.

During this process, Jenna emphasizes the importance of being flexible and adaptable. Organizations must be willing to adjust their plans as new information emerges or as circumstances change. This may involve pivoting to a new approach, modifying existing tactics, or abandoning certain strategies altogether.

Another critical element of tactical execution analysis, according to Jenna, is communication. It's essential to keep all stakeholders informed throughout the process, including team members, executives, and external partners.

This requires clear and concise messaging, regular updates, and a willingness to listen and respond to feedback. By maintaining open lines of communication, organizations can ensure that everyone is aligned and working towards the same goals.

Finally, Jenna highlights the importance of accountability. At every stage of the tactical execution analysis process, it's vital to hold individuals and teams responsible for their actions and outcomes.

This means setting clear expectations, providing ample resources and support, and measuring progress against agreed-upon targets. When everyone is held accountable, there is a greater sense of ownership and commitment to achieving success.

In conclusion, tactical execution analysis is a crucial component of any successful business strategy. With a clear understanding of goals and objectives, a flexible and adaptable approach, effective communication, and a culture of accountability, organizations can achieve meaningful results and drive growth and success. As Jenna Jamison has demonstrated throughout her career, a strategic and data-driven approach to tactical execution analysis can make all the difference.
